dc.description.abstractWe report on a new polyfluorene derivative containing a spiroanthracenefluorene unit with a remote C-10 position that provides facile substitution of alkyl groups. An ethylhexyl group was introduced into the spiroanthracenefluorene unit and the ethylhexyl-substituted spiroanthracenefluorene was polymerized via an Ni(0)-mediated polymerization. The polymer showed a high spectral stability with respect to heat treatment, UV irradiation, and high current passage. A light-emitting device based on this polymer showed an emission in a deep blue region with CIE color coordinates of x= 0.17 and y= 0.12.en
